A man in a plaid shirt pets a German Shepherd dog in a home setting, the dog circling and lying down as he strokes its back. The footage, shot on 8mm film in 1968, shows warm, slightly faded colors and natural film grain, capturing an intimate moment between owner and pet. The man wears casual clothing and smiles as he interacts with the dog, which appears relaxed and content. The scene unfolds in a modest interior with wood-paneled walls and soft lighting, evoking a nostalgic, personal home movie feel. This authentic 8mm home movie captures everyday life and the bond between humans and animals in the late 1960s.
